Circuit Training Exercise for a Full Body Workout

circuit training exercise

Circuit training has earned recognition as one of the most effective ways to workout. It combines strength training and cardio, creating a highly efficient exercise format that delivers significant benefits in less time. Let’s dive into the compelling world of circuit training exercise.

Unleashing the Power of Circuit Training Exercises

Understanding Circuit Training

Circuit training is a workout methodology where you perform a series of exercises in rapid succession, usually with minimal breaks in between. The “circuit” refers to a complete round of the prescribed exercises, and you generally repeat the circuit multiple times. This form of exercise effectively blends cardiovascular activity with strength training, leading to a balanced and comprehensive workout that improves both muscular strength and cardiovascular endurance.

The Benefits of Circuit Training

Circuit training exercises offer a multitude of benefits:

Efficiency: These routines typically combine multiple forms of exercise, thus making them time-efficient. You get to work on various muscle groups and your cardiovascular fitness in one fell swoop.

Versatility: They are highly versatile. The variety of exercises you can incorporate into a circuit is nearly limitless.

Calorie Burning: The high-intensity nature of circuit training can result in a high calorie burn.

Improved Cardiovascular Health: By keeping your heart rate up throughout the workout, circuit training can significantly improve cardiovascular health.

Muscular Strength and Endurance: Strength-based exercise in circuit training can help build muscle strength and endurance.

Sample CTE

Here’s a sample circuit workout that you can try at home or at the gym. This routine includes both strength and cardio components, designed to work the entire body.

Circuit:

Jumping Jacks (Cardio): Start your circuit with 1 minute of jumping jacks to get your heart rate up.

Push-ups (Upper body): Next, perform 15-20 push-ups. This exercise targets your chest, shoulders, and triceps.

Squats (Lower body): Do 15-20 squats to work your glutes, quads, and hamstrings.

Mountain Climbers (Cardio/Core): Spend another minute doing mountain climbers, a fantastic exercise for your cardiovascular system and core. (circuit training exercise)

Lunges (Lower body): Perform 10-15 lunges on each leg. Lunges target your quads, hamstrings, and glutes.

Plank (Core): Finish the circuit with a 30-second plank to work your core.

Rest for about a minute, then repeat the circuit 2-3 more times. Adjust the numbers based on your fitness level.

Circuit Training Tips

Here are a few tips to help you maximize your circuit training:

Customize Your Circuit: Tailor your circuit to meet your specific fitness goals. If you’re looking to build strength, incorporate more strength exercises into your circuit. If you’re focusing on cardiovascular health, emphasize cardio exercises.

Maintain Good Form: It’s easy to rush through exercise in circuit training, but maintaining proper form is crucial to prevent injury and maximize effectiveness.

Manage Rest Periods: The aim of circuit training is to keep your heart rate up, so keep rest periods short. If you need more recovery time, it’s better to slow down the pace of your exercises rather than extending rest periods.

Hydrate: Circuit training can be intense. Ensure you stay well-hydrated throughout your workout.

Warm-Up and Cool-Down: Just like any workout, begin with a warm-up and finish with a cool-down phase to prep your body for exercise and aid recovery.
